DAGS,

I believe the Cummins will get you upwards of 20mpg, but not with 4.10gears!

A cummins with 4.10s = hell of a work truck
A cummins with 3.73 = great work truck with good mileage.

My dad has a 04 3500 with a chip and intake turning 430hp with 3.73 gears. When pulling a 28ft 5th @ 19,000lbs combined wt will get between 8-10mpg. It gets thirsty, but doesn't skip a beat.
